So, How Often Should I Service My Electric Bike?

Good question. In the UK, most riders are alright with a full e-bike service once a year. That’s the baseline. But if you're using it every day, maybe for work, or hitting long routes often, you’ll want to give it a bit more attention. Think of it like a car MOT, but cheaper and less hassle.

Keeping Your E-Bike Battery Going Strong

Your battery’s not something you want to mess up. Want it to last? Don’t let it fully drain all the time. Avoid leaving it out in the cold and never overcharge it. If you're storing it during winter, bring it indoors and keep it at a steady temp. That’s solid electric bike battery care. Helps you avoid problems like it refusing to charge or dying too soon.

Cleaning Your Electric Bike Properly

Please, no pressure washers. You don’t want to force water into the electrics. Use a damp cloth, a soft brush maybe, and keep the soap gentle. Dry it off fully before storing or reconnecting the battery. Simple stuff really. It’s part of basic electric bicycle upkeep and saves you a ton of grief down the line.

How to Tell If Your E-Bike Needs Servicing

Funny noises, sudden power drops, wobbly brakes. These are your signs. Also if your e-bike battery is not charging like it used to, or the assist cuts in and out. That’s a red flag. Keep an eye out for anything odd. Even small changes matter.

The UK Weather and Your E-Bike

Ah yes, our famous British weather. Rain, damp, and cold don’t go well with electrics. So dry it off after wet rides, keep it indoors if possible, and check for corrosion. Good to remember when it comes to winter e-bike storage or general electric motor maintenance.

What Should I Check Before Riding?

Before heading out, have a quick scan. Battery level, brakes working, chain okay, tyres pumped. That quick pre-ride e-bike check can save you from a flat tyre or worse, a dead motor halfway through your route. It's a tiny effort really.
